Project Team Leader
About the Role
PuroClean, a leader in emergency property restoration services, helps families and businesses overcome the devastating setbacks caused by water, fire, mold, biohazard, and other conditions resulting in property damage. We operate with a ‘servant-based leadership’ mindset and seek to create an environment where our team members can grow both professionally and spiritually through serving our customers, communities, and each other.
With a ‘One Team’ mentality, manage and complete jobs according to PuroClean processes per work order. Respond to service calls when needed. Set up and establish efficient job flow, coordinate requirements for the job, complete job documentation, perform and supervise production work, and monitor assigned jobs from start to finish. Follow and enforce all safety procedures on the job site.
Responsibilities
- Manage and complete jobs according to PuroClean processes, ensuring customer satisfaction and representing the brand.
- Respond to service calls, set up efficient job flow, and coordinate job requirements.
- Complete job documentation accurately and in a timely manner.
- Perform and supervise production work, monitoring jobs from start to finish.
- Follow and enforce all safety procedures on job sites.
- Perform sales and marketing activities, including add-on sales and security checks.
- Communicate and establish relationships with commercial, insurance, and residential customers.
- Maintain production costs at the established rate.
- Ensure timely communication with Project Manager, Operations Manager, General Manager, or Owner, and customers.
- Effectively perform all aspects of the production processes and continue developing production skills.
- Manage financial assets and equipment.
- Follow all uniform and policy guidelines in line with the Brand Identity Guide.
- Maintain a clean and orderly appearance at job sites.
- Coach and train production staff technicians.
- Perform preventative maintenance on vehicles, equipment, and oversee facility maintenance.
- Ensure clear communication with office staff, immediate supervisor, and fellow technicians.
Qualifications
- Willingness for continued learning and growth, with the ability to ‘lead and coach’ teammates.
- Attention to detail in organization, cleanliness, and care for facility, assets, and equipment.
- Aptitude for record keeping, recording information, and communicating effectively.
- Awareness and respect for safety, using care and caution with teammates and customers.
- Strength in multitasking, handling deadlines, and organizational and leadership skills.
- Ability to lift at least 50 lbs. and comfort standing on your feet for prolonged periods.
